Clinical Research Fellow in Paediatric Hepatology - Birmingham, United Kingdom - Birmingham Women's and Children's NHS Foundation Trust

Description
Scientific Research opportunities include:
Co-ordination of UK wide 3 centre study on donor specific antibodies following liver transplantation Co-ordination of an ESPGHAN Networking Grant secured for Immune mediated complications following intestinal transplantation.
Presentations and publications Grant applications (NIHR funding has been secured for two years for submitting grant applications in children with liver diseases Gut microbiota and liver disease Mucosal immune cytokine pathways in intestinal transplantation Sarcopenia and Frailty in chronic liver disease Donor cell free DNA in liver transplantation participation in Laboratory based Basic Science Research (in collaboration with The Institute of Biomedical Research (IBR), providing opportunities for research on infection, immunity, and stem cell therapeutics in state of the art laboratory facilities)Clinical Research opportunities include:
Experience as sub-investigator in Liver Unit clinical trials (Viral hepatitis/ immunosuppression/cholestasis trials/ Wilsons Disease trials) Clinical audit projects evaluating outcome of liver disease
